RAPE

RAPE is a painting by Marilyn Manson. It was also exhibited in his art show, Hell, Etc.. It depicts the face of a person (possibly Manson) with the word "RAPE" written towards the bottom.

Trivia

  • The painting features a monochromatic color scheme of red, causing usage of blood as a medium to be questionable. If so, this is not the only work by Manson to feature blood as a material.
